According to reports, Stuart Holden is set to land a Premier League contract with Bolton Wanderers.

The Sun claims Bolton boss Owen Coyle hopes to sign American midfielder Holden from Houston Dynamo today.

Holden is currently out of contract with Houston and looking for first-team action in readiness for the World Cup this summer in South Africa.

The 24-year-old Scottish-born star impressed during a two-week trial at the Reebok.
